User Management: getUserSession

I am trying to implement getUserSession. However, as the find method returns iterable interface, how can I cast interface to the session object. The reason for casting is that the return type of getUserSession method is session.


Chapter 1: Driver Setup

Using POJO - Part 1 and 2.

I am having the same issue. Here is my code:

public Session getUserSession(String userId) {

    return sessionsCollection.find(Filters.eq("user_id", userId)).first();

I though using this way I would automatically get a session object. But that does not seem to be correct. Any ideas? Any one?

What do you get? Any exception or error message?

Following up here: